Fever in children is the body's defensive response to disease. To a certain extent, fever in children is not entirely a bad thing. For some diseases, it can even help the patient recover, so there is no need to rush to take measures to reduce the temperature and fever. However, if a child's fever lasts too long or the temperature is too high, it can cause damage to the body, especially have an adverse effect on the central nervous system, and even endanger life.

When a child has a fever, you should pay close attention to the symptoms. If the temperature is not very high and the general condition is good, the child can be treated and rested at home.

Some people give antipyretics to their children as soon as they see that they have a fever, hoping to lower the temperature in a short time. This practice is not advisable, because there are many reasons for children to have a fever. Hastily lowering the temperature before clarifying the condition can only cover up the condition and delay treatment. At the same time, any disease that causes fever in children takes a process, and the treatment of the disease also takes some time, so the disease should be treated comprehensively. For example, if you have a fever due to inflammation, your body temperature will naturally return to normal after the inflammation is eliminated. If you just take antipyretics, your body temperature will drop immediately, but it will rise again soon.

For children with fever, it is best to use physical cooling methods and do not use various antipyretic drugs easily to prevent toxic reactions. First of all, you should adjust the temperature of the room and keep the air circulating. For example, you can open doors and windows or use fans to speed up air circulation, which is conducive to heat dissipation and cooling. You can also use ice or cold water to apply to the child's head, neck, armpits and bilateral groin to reduce fever. When applying ice, wrap the ice bag with a layer of cloth to prevent local skin frostbite. Wiping with 35-40% alcohol or 30°C warm water can dilate skin capillaries and accelerate water evaporation, which is also a fairly simple way to reduce fever. When using alcohol bath, be careful not to wipe the child's head, face, and chest.

When physical cooling methods are ineffective, appropriate pediatric antipyretic drugs can be used under the guidance of a doctor.

When children have a fever, they should be fed boiled water or sugar water frequently. Drinking water can replenish the water evaporated due to fever. Children sweat after drinking water, and the evaporation of water can help reduce fever. In addition, increased urination can also allow some heat to be removed through urine, accelerating the reduction of fever.
